Esther Freud

Esther Freud (2 May 1963) is a British novelist. Born in London, she is the daughter of painter Lucian Freud and Bernadine Coverley and is the great-granddaughter of Sigmund Freud. Freud travelled extensively with her mother as a child, and returned to London at the age of sixteen to train as an actress at The Drama Centre.
